Palestinian Envoy To UN Calls On Int'l Community To Forbid Israel's Criminal Plans
(MENAFN- Kuwait News Agency (KUNA))
NEW YORK, Sept 19 (KUNA) -- Palestine's Permanent Representative to the United Nations Ambassador Riyad Mansour called on the international community to take decisive measures to deter Israel from continuing "to implement its criminal plans."
This came in a speech Amb. Mansour delivered Thursday evening before the UN Security Council, after it failed to adopt a draft resolution calling for an immediate, unconditional, and permanent ceasefire in Gaza due to the United States' use of its veto.
He stressed that the international community has the ability to implement immediate and effective accountability measures, by deploying an international protection force to Gaza".
He called on the leaders who will gather in New York during the General Assembly's high-level week to "take decisions that will save Gaza, Palestine, and peace process in the Middle East".
The Palestinian delegate announced that the General Assembly would vote Friday on a resolution calling for the presence of Palestinian leaders in New York to attend the General Assembly's high-level week.
On Thursday, the Security Council failed to adopt a draft resolution calling for an immediate, unconditional, and permanent ceasefire in Gaza after the United States used its veto, while 14 of the 15 council members supported the draft.
The draft resolution was submitted by the ten non-permanent members of the Security Council including Pakistan, Panama, Algeria, the Republic of Korea, Denmark, Slovenia, Sierra Leone, Somalia, Guyana, and Greece.(end)
